A rare case of a pulmonary valve papillary fibroelastoma

Abstract: Case: A 67-year-old female presented with an exceedingly rare cardiac neoplasmpapillary fibroelastoma. This is made rarer still as it occurred on the pulmonary valve. The patient complained of a prolonged history of chest discomfort. Magnetic resonance imaging and echocardiography revealed a pulmonary valve papillary fibroelastoma.
